Effect of Different Tannery Sludge Composts on the Production of Ryegrass: A Pot Experiment

Abstract: Background: Tannery industry produces high amounts of nutrient rich sludges that can be used as organic fertilizers. Objective: The aim of this study was to evaluate the fertilizing potential of composted tannery sludge.
